00:06:23.000 In any case, Here's what Trump actually did.
00:06:26.000 According to CNN, Trump tried to assert executive power, signing four actions on coronavirus relief on Saturday, one of which will provide as much as $400 in enhanced unemployment benefits after Democrats in the White House were unable to reach an agreement on a stimulus bill this week.
00:06:39.000 That memorandum on enhanced unemployment benefits, 25% of which states are being asked to cover, has a lot of strings attached.
00:06:46.000 It is seen as a cumbersome effort that may not help a lot of the unemployed.
00:06:48.000 I love how CNN covers this stuff, right?
00:06:50.000 If Barack Obama signs an executive order to do anything, literally anything, Then it was a good move.
00:06:55.000 It was always a good move.
00:06:56.000 DACA was a good move.
00:06:57.000 Delaying the employer mandate was a good move.
00:07:00.000 And it was definitely going to help the American people.
00:07:01.000 Trump does something to act in the absence of congressional action.
00:07:05.000 And it's obviously a bad move.
00:07:06.000 Always.
00:07:07.000 Because his last name is Trump, obviously.
00:07:08.000 The other three actions he signed include a memorandum on a payroll tax holiday for Americans earning less than $100,000 a year, an executive order on assistance to renters and homeowners, and a memo on deferring student loan payments.
00:07:19.000 Some of these he has more executive authority for.
00:07:20.000 Some of these he really does not.
00:07:22.000 Delaying the payroll tax.
00:07:23.000 He has some executive authority for that, given what Barack Obama did.
00:07:28.000 Deferring student loan payments.
00:07:29.000 He has a lot of executive authority for that, actually, under the existing law.
00:07:32.000 He didn't really do anything about assistance to renters and homeowners.
00:07:36.000 He basically kicked it over to the Housing and Urban Development Department to assess what they could do.
00:07:42.000 And then on unemployment, he basically kicked that to the states.
00:07:45.000 Trump said in a memorandum on the unemployment benefits at his golf club in Bedminster, I'm taking action to provide an additional or extra $400 a week and expanded benefits.
00:07:53.000 $400, that's generous, but we want to take care of our people.
00:07:56.000 In order for this to happen, a state has to enter into a financial arrangement with the federal government for any unemployed person living there to get any of the additional benefits.
00:08:03.000 And the federal government is requiring states to pick up the tab for $100 of the $400 additional benefit each person may be able to receive weekly in additional aid.
00:08:12.000 Up to $44 billion from the Disaster Relief Fund would be made available for lost wage assistance.
00:08:16.000 So he has the ability, under executive law, he does have the ability to shift some funds from sort of general funding under the Disaster Relief Fund.
00:08:22.000 It's stretching the definition, for sure.
00:08:25.000 And it is constitutionally questionable, as I say.
00:08:27.000 It is also politically smart.
00:08:29.000 And the way you can tell that it's politically smart is the Democrats are losing their minds.
00:08:32.000 They are very, very upset about this because they thought they had them boxed in.
00:08:35.000 They thought that simply by preventing any sort of relief package from taking place, they would be able to turn around and blame Republicans.
00:08:42.000 A Democratic official said that Democrats were not given any heads up on the executive action.
00:08:46.000 They said their funds are completely tapped.
00:08:49.000 And so the states won't be able to help out.
00:08:51.000 In fact, states have asked Congress to provide them with an additional $500 billion to help shore up their budgets, which have been crushed by the loss of tax revenue amid the pandemic.
00:09:01.000 Several experts told CNN there are major questions about how many states may be able to afford the extra cost if a state says it doesn't have the funds or doesn't want to enter into an agreement with the feds.
00:09:09.000 The unemployed in that state would receive zero dollars in the extra benefits.
00:09:14.000 They would still receive normal state unemployment insurance.

00:27:56.000 So, over the weekend, there was a report that the top U.S.
00:28:00.000 intelligence officials, counterintelligence officials, have been warning of foreign interference in our elections.
00:28:05.000 And what they found is that the Russians have been trying to interfere on behalf of Donald Trump, that the Chinese have been trying to interfere on behalf of Joe Biden, and that the Iranians have been trying to interfere on behalf of Joe Biden.
00:28:15.000 They put out a statement and said, we assess that China prefers that President Trump does not win re-election.
00:28:20.000 China has been expanding its influence efforts ahead of November 2020.
00:28:23.000 Although China will continue to weigh the risks and benefits of aggressive action, its public rhetoric over the past few months has grown increasingly critical of the current administration.
00:28:31.000 Okay, on Russia, we assess that Russia is using a range of measures to primarily denigrate former Vice President Biden and what it sees as an anti-Russia establishment.
00:28:38.000 This is consistent with Moscow's public criticism of him when he was vice president for his role in the Obama administration's policies in Ukraine.
00:28:46.000 Some Kremlin linked actors are seeking to boost President Trump's candidacy on social media and Russian TV.
00:28:51.000 Iran.
00:28:52.000 We assess that Iran seeks to undermine U.S.
00:28:53.000 democratic institutions, President Trump, and to divide the country in advance of 2020.
00:28:56.000 Iran's efforts along these lines probably will focus on online influence, such as spreading disinformation on social media and recirculating anti-U.S.
00:29:04.000 content.
00:29:05.000 Tehran's motivation is in part driven by perception that Trump's reelection would result in a continuation of U.S.
00:29:10.000 pressure on Iran.
